.Prologue.

She walked listlessly along the city streets, oblivious to the sights and sounds around her. Her face was completely void of any emotions. It had been long, too long, since she slipped into such a trance.

            Lifting her head, she looked at the night sky and tried to remember when she had last slept in a proper bed. The realization of what day it was hit her hard. Real hard.

            Saturday. The day reserved for couples, she thought bitterly. Somehow, despite all her efforts, she had not managed to do what she set out to accomplish. She hated herself for that. Out of no where, the memories came drifting back to her. She felt faint, and the world around her seemed to slip into darkness. A lump rose in her throat. No. No …

            And the sound of raindrops hitting the pathway was the last thing she heard or remembered, before letting the darkness consume her.

.::||::.

.Nostalgia.

            She woke up to the sound of raindrops and tried to adjust to her surroundings. It all looked too familiar, didn’t it?

            “Miss … daijoubu des ka?”

            She turned and looked at her saviour. Saviour. She silently cursed her weak body. She disliked being saved, being the poor damsel in distress. She narrowed her eyes and glared at him, sending him a look filled with contempt and disgust. She was supposed to be the strong person. Not the other way round. She did not need anyone, to take pity on her, to help her.

            The boy backed off a little. A slight smile spread across her beautiful face. It’s my apartment. No wonder it was so familiar. She took a moment to take in the way her apartment looked. It felt so good to be home. She laid on her bed, lost in her own thoughts.

            “Miss?”

            She snapped at him. “What?” And rubbed her eyes. It couldn’t be. She sat up straight, and stared at the boy, then scrutinized him from head to toe. The boy ran his hand through his dark locks of hair and gulped.

            “I was wondering … if you’re …”

            “How the f*** did you get here? And what am I doing here?”

             The boy now looked alarm. Good. She had managed to caught him off-guard.

            “Your house keys. You lost consciousness in the park. I happened to be there. I was wondering where to take you when your house keys and student ID fell out of your pocket.”

            Damn. How could she be so stupid? “And you thought you were so smart, acting on your own.” she spat out the words.

            The boy blushed a shade of pink, then nodded. She looked at him once more, relieved that this boy, no matter how alike he looked to him, he wasn’t him. [A/N: in case anyone gets confused here, the he and the him are two different people. ^o^] Him. Just a mere thought of him made her head spin, and she grabbed her side table for support. He grabbed her arm instinctively to help her, but she pried his fingers off furiously.

            “I can stand on my own.”

            “Ha.. Hai.” He bowed politely to her, then walked out of her bedroom and shut the door. He smiled wryly to himself. He would have never, in all the seventeen years of his life, imagined he would meet a girl like her. A total contrast to the girls he had dated. Or rather, she belonged to a different and rare species of the opposite gender. Before her, he lost his tongue. He was in her control.

He walked around her apartment. She lives here alone? A million questions ran through his mind, but he knew he barely had the courage to ask the hot-tempered girl. On reflection, he thought that she wasn’t exactly hot-tempered. Just very different, he mused.

            He walked to the small stereo placed on the coffee table and picked up a couple of unlabelled cassette tapes. He was just about to put one of them into the stereo when –

            “Don’t you dare touch my things. Who do you think you are, coming into my house uninvited and touching MY stuff? I don’t need any pity OR sympathy from you.” He knew he was right not to expect any gratitude from her. Ignoring her words, he popped the cassette tape into the stereo. She was furious. Hobbling on one foot, she made her way gradually through her living room. How dare he? He stood up and offered to help her, but all he did was receive a cold, hard slap. He grabbed her arm --

            She knew she was defeated. The anger inside her, had always been washed away whenever she heard this song. Her heart softened, and she slumped into her sofa, with tears misting in her eyes. You said it was our song. That no matter what, you’ll be here. She couldn’t cry. She had to be strong. But still, defeated, the tears slowly slipped down her face.

           

“ … …

Just hold on tight kokoro kujikete mo

Reach into your soul ashita ga mienakute mo

Yes, chigau sekai ga atte

You can take another look from the other side

ai no subete ni deau made...

(Just hold on tight, even if your heart is breaking.

Reach into your soul, even if you can't see tomorrow.

Yes, there's another world out there.

You can take another look from the other side,

until you find all that is love...)”

            The song slowly faded. He looked at her still form. He didn’t realise it then, but now he saw her in a different light. She was beautiful. Beautiful, in a way, which was also hard to look at. Just the unfathomable expression on her face, just one look at her, could break anyone’s heart. The tears kept on slipping down on her face, but she made no attempt to wipe them off. She just stared at the stereo.

            She was at a loss of words. She felt that familiar rush of nostalgia. How she longed for the past. How she heart ached everytime Saturday arrived.

           

Saturday. It’s a day for us!”

            “Us?”

            “Baka. Saturday is a day for couples! You and I.”

            And the Sakura Festival. She remembered the promise, made to her. Of how she would never have to spend watching cherry blossoms alone again. She was so naïve. Too naïve for her own good. To believe that he was her soulmate. As the next song came on, it brought even more tears to her eyes. Damn that bloody piano piece.

            Finally. The piano piece ended. He stood there, amazed by her by the second. How could she just sit through those songs, with tears streaming down her face, but still look totally at peace? He decided to pluck up his courage and ask her.

            “Hey. Those songs …”

            She cut him off coldly. “Never. Ever. Touch. My. Tapes.”

            He nodded. She was straight to the point, and he knew it. Knew it too damn well, but he was still mystified by her. Curiosity gave him the courage. The courage to know her and her past. He stopped the tape and took it out, then put another tape in. What happened next completely shocked him. That song again?

            He pressed the forward button, but the same song appeared. But what mystified him was the voice, the singer of the song. It was completely different from the previous song he had heard. This voice, had a strong edge to it, but he could hear beneath that. He heard the urgency in the voice, the unspoken words in the song. It was an appeal for help. And at that moment, he decided that he would make this girl known to the world.

Years of being in the music business had taught him well. The singer of this song, whether original or not [A/N: as in, whether the singer is the original singer or not. ^^ not the song], was clearly something. She had a talent. Suddenly it all made sense it his mind.

            “Is that your voice?”

            For once, he was bewildered as to why she didn’t retort at him but just merely nodded. She stood up and stopped the stereo, then stacked up the tapes one after another.

“My demo tape. I cut it when …” she stopped. She didn’t have the energy to go on. She was good at concealing her emotions and feelings, she knew that very well. So far she had been able to hide him from the whole world. To live on her life as she did, but painfully. If she went on, she knew she would completely break down.

I’m starting a band! I need you as my vocal singer. Will you agree?”

She nodded, too happy for words. He needed her. In a way, at least. She thought she’ll never find anyone who needed her again, after her father died.

He beamed at her. “Great! But I need a band name.” Sighing, he plucked a dandelion and twisted it into a ring.

            She looked at the setting of the sun against the horizon. She was living in such bliss. Suddenly, it came to her. “Misora.”

            “What?”

            “Misora. Beautiful sky.” she answered simply.

            “Of course! You’re a genius!” He turned around and faced her, then slipped the ring onto her finger. Smiling, he pressed his lips gently against her. “Together forever … Rika-chan …”

            “ … and so I’m wondering. Would you join us?”

            Reality snapped her out of her fantasy. She looked at the guy, completely clueless. He gave a look of irritation.

            “I’m starting a band. As the manager and guitarist. Would you join us as a lead singer?”
